Geisleithen
Geisleithen is a hamlet in Plößberg, Markt, Tirschenreuth, Bavaria. Geisleithen is situated nearby to the village Plößberg, as well as near the hamlet Krähenhaus.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Flossenbürg
Village
Photo: Nikater, Public domain.
Flossenbürg is a municipality in the district of Neustadt an der Waldnaab in Bavaria in Germany. The state-approved leisure area is located in the Bavarian Forest and borders Bohemia in the east. Flossenbürg is situated 6 km south of Geisleithen.
